Transaction 531fdbc1688b3c8583e208fa1cfbff78b5dfaf8970925489d516419dd5c6154b

1 Input
2 Outputs
  • 531fdbc1688b3c8583e208fa1cfbff78b5dfaf8970925489d516419dd5c6154b:0
  • value  768678
    address  344GcwhUEPAmPw2o1taFxbw8LRYShpvDXk
  • 531fdbc1688b3c8583e208fa1cfbff78b5dfaf8970925489d516419dd5c6154b:1
  • value  50452934
    address  bc1q72euxjwwknm6t3z0tngm7pyg0jdwk7d862tz0yvt8ju633gsvvxqhkrgdw